jtenniswood/espcontrol
Esphome based smart home control panel
About the project
ESPHome-based firmware for ESP32 touchscreens that turns them into a Home Assistant control panel without writing code or YAML. Cards, pages and actions are configured through the device's built-in web page.
Useful for
- Flash the firmware onto an ESP32 screen and pair it with Home Assistant over WiFi
- Configure buttons for lights, scenes and thermostats from the panel's web page
- Place a panel by the door or bedside for quick access to scenes and sensors
